History Manchester, Maryland



north main st, circa 1900


from 18th century until earliest parts of 20th century, primary languages spoken residents german, or pennsylvania dutch. custom of german residents of making noodles , stringing them on lines outside homes give town nickname noodle doosey . later, manchester receive nickname when german custom of making ginger cakes brought on gingercake town . manchester relatively large cigar manufacturing town, after civil war until around 1930, when mass production of cigars made manual method in use in town less economical.


manchester home of 1 of first colleges in carroll county when, in 1858, irving college, named after poet washington irving, established dr. ferdinand dieffenbach. during civil war success of school hampered death of dr. dieffenbach , low number of young men returning front lines. school changed name irving institute in 1886 , ceased operation 1893.


during american civil war, manchester used camping area union sixth army corps under general john sedgwick on july 1, 1863. next day, army made march battle of gettysburg.


manchester has had 3 newspapers. first, called manchester gazette, began publishing weekly in 1870 , ceased in 1872. second went print on december 11, 1880, , called manchester enterprise, , in 1888 telephone messenger established.



lutheran white oak


the official seal of town of manchester church steeple in foreground , likeness of leaf-less tree in background text founded 1765 incorporated 1834 .


the image of tree representation of white oak , considered town symbol. lutheran white oak , has come known, estimated @ 320 years old. large oak became fixture of town when, in 1758, king george iii granted charter german colonists erect church near tree. town newsletter named oaknotes homage large white oak tree.


manchester typical main street town continues expanding accommodate growing population. manchester has own post office, , home mail delivery available residents. majority, estimated 95%, of town residents commute work. there no large employers inside town limits, there many small businesses. manchester residential buildings, restaurants, bank , other small retail storefronts. large portion of businesses located on or around main street maryland route 30 becomes once entering downtown manchester.
